## Veltrix Line Retirement — Managers Only

The Veltrix product line sunsets at end of Q3. Support contracts wind down over six months; no new orders after the cutoff. Marren leads customer migration to the Orbi platform. Budget reallocation is already approved. For the incoming director: the transition plan below is confidential and should not circulate beyond this page.

internal memo for kahap-hahig: Only 7 of the 120 pilot accounts renewed Zorix, so a churn review is set for January 15.

Runbook: Finish-line chip reader (Mirelle Timing, Harrowdale Marathon deployment). The reader polls RFID mats every 50ms and signs each read with the unit's device key before upload. Keys rotate per event; old keys are revoked at teardown. If signature failures exceed 2%, isolate the unit and re-provision — never bypass verification. The threat model, key-rotation procedure, and audit log format are documented on the internal page here.

wiki page, tahaf-tajog: https://jira.ordindyn.corp/pipeline

Subject: Fire-drill roll call — Thursday

Hi all,

A reminder that the quarterly fire drill at Calloway House takes place Thursday at 10:30. Team assistants are responsible for roll call at the assembly point on Merrow Green. Please collect your team's attendance clipboard from the front desk beforehand. The clipboards are kept in the cupboard beside the post pigeonholes, which stays locked. You can open it with the code below.

door code, yagap-bahof: bdg-O-05